This is a gukbap house near Songjeong Station. The pork broth is clear and clean rather than heavy and milky, with suyuk plates catching arrivals and departures.

Owner storyWords · SpotKorea Editorial Team2026-07-09
“Station gukbap can be fast, but it still has to show care.”

This is a husband-and-wife gukbap house in front of Songjeong Station. He washes pork bones and shoulder at 4 a.m.; she opens the chive salad and kkakdugi jars at 6. As they say, “Station gukbap can be fast, but it still has to show care,” bowls arrive within five minutes, yet the broth has been held over low heat since the night before. Foam is skimmed three times at the first boil for clarity, and suyuk is boiled for 40 minutes, then covered with a damp cloth. They laugh that “when guests ask about train time, we check the clock before the soup.” One traveler missed the last train, ate a slow plate of suyuk, left on the first train next morning, and now takes the same window seat whenever he returns to Gwangju.

Behind the Signature

Clear pork gukbap does not hide aroma under seasoning. Salted shrimp is the final adjustment; add chive salad in halves, not all at once.
